MCS - 'Top Gun: Maverick' cruises to holiday record
Top Gun: Maverick (NASDAQ:PARA) (NASDAQ:PARAA) soared over the weekend, setting a record for Memorial Day weekend openings and becoming star Tom Cruise's first $100 million debut in the process. The sequel 36 years in the making drew $126 million over the three-day weekend, and paced toward $156 million counting Monday's Memorial Day holiday - which would top the full-weekend record of $153 million held by Johnny Depp film Pirates of the Caribbean: At World's End in 2007. It was behind the record pace before a better Sunday than expected. The opening-day total of $51.8 million was a Paramount Pictures record (beating 2010's Iron Man 2). Top Gun: Maverick added $124 million more in international grosses, even though it's limited by not playing in China and Russia.
